
How does a small business send large files that are too massive or too sensitive by email? Large corporations often solve this problem with large custom-built extranets, but small businesses have typically resorted to burning and shipping the files on CD. ShareFile makes the functionality of a large corporate extranet available to small businesses in a package that is affordable, easy to use, and professional. <A HREF="http://www.prweb.com/releases/2006/2/prweb341964.htm">Files can be shared in two ways</A> with ShareFile. The first is similar to traditional FTP, with files uploaded to password-protected online folders. Though unlike FTP, ShareFile transfers files securely and boasts robust features such as easy user administration, e-mail alerts, keyword searches on folders and files, and virus scans on all files. The second way to share files, ideal for easy one-time file transfers, is to send large files via a hyperlink in an e-mail message. ShareFile can send a hyperlink to any e-mail address, allowing recipients to download files or entire folders by just clicking the link with no login required.
